I'm upset that I never experienced the "Float Trip" - we were there when it was in existence, but somehow my parents kept that hid from us.
American Plunge used to be a really great ride when the tunnel had all the effects within it. Now it's just concrete walls. I do wish they would do something, but replacing that concrete would be extremely expensive.
Jay
What kind of effects did it have in the tunnel of American Plunge?
There were different show scenes in the cave, but the one thing that stood out to me were the "3d face effects" . I think they called it a haunted cave.
Jay
There also was a scene where there was a boat wreck with a fountain effect and another spot where it looked as if your log was going to be over run with water rushing down the wall at you. Both instances had some "past champion" characters that you were introduced to on some signage along the queue.
